A Risky Proposition: Vacant Homes

Leaving a house empty can incur unnecessary insurance risks. Theft, vandalism, fire and water damage are more likely to occur. Think carefully before leaving your former home vacant. Read more.


New Bling from Your Valentine? Make Sure It’s Covered

When you purchase an item with considerable value like jewelry, you should contact our agency to find out if any additional coverage is needed. Insuring your jewelry will keep it financially protected if it is lost or stolen. Learn more about insuring precious gifts.
